Senior secondary assessment methods in the Northern Territory
Student work in the NTCET is assessed through the use of performance standards. The NT uses the South Australian curriculum. SACE subjects are school assessed at Stage 1. The responsibility for assessment at Stage 2 is shared between schools and the SACE Board.
The performance standards, which are provided in each subject outline, describe in detail the level of achievement required to obtain a grade:
- from A to E for Stage 1
- from A+ to E– for Stage 2.

Senior secondary reporting in the Northern Territory
The NT Board of Studies reports final subject grades at Stage 1 using grades from A to E. At Stage 2 the NT Board of Studies reports grade levels from A+ to E–. The subject grades for both Stage 1 and Stage 2 are based on the performance standards described in each subject outline, and are reported on a student’s Record of Achievement.
Reporting at the end of the compulsory years in the Northern Territory
When a student has fulfilled all of the requirements of the Northern Territory Certificate of Education and Training they are awarded the certificate, which includes the student’s name, SACE registration number, date of issue, and is signed by the Chair of the NT Board of Studies.
